Abstract
The elasto/acousto-optic (A-O) and electro-optic (E-O) coefficients of Pb(Zn1/3Nb2/3)O3-PbTiO3 (PZN-PT) single crystals with a broad composition range (i.e. PZN with 0, 4.5, 8, 10, 12 mol% PT) are reported. The A-O coefficients were studied in both hydrostatic pressure and uniaxial stress conditions at room temperature. The E-O coefficients were studied at temperatures from -20°C to 80°C. It is found that the crystal with the composition near the morphotropic phase boundary (MPB) exhibits very large A-O and E-O coefficients. More importantly, the E-O coefficient is nearly independent of the temperature in the studied temperature range in tetragonal side.
